Intel Core i9-10980HK or Qualcomm Snapdragon 712 - which processor is faster? In this comparison we look at the differences and analyze which of these two CPUs is better. We compare the technical data and benchmark results.

The Intel Core i9-10980HK has 8 cores with 16 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 5.30 GHz. Up to 128 GB of memory is supported in 2 memory channels. The Intel Core i9-10980HK was released in Q2/2020.

The Qualcomm Snapdragon 712 has 8 cores with 8 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 2.30 GHz. The CPU supports up to 8 GB of memory in 2 memory channels. The Qualcomm Snapdragon 712 was released in Q1/2019.

Memory & PCIe

The Intel Core i9-10980HK can use up to 128 GB of memory in 2 memory channels. The maximum memory bandwidth is 46.9 GB/s. The Qualcomm Snapdragon 712 supports up to 8 GB of memory in 2 memory channels and achieves a memory bandwidth of up to 14.9 GB/s.

AnTuTu 9 Benchmark

The AnTuTu 9 benchmark is very well suited to measuring the performance of a smartphone. AnTuTu 9 is quite heavy on 3D graphics and can now also use the "Metal" graphics interface. In AnTuTu, memory and UX (user experience) are also tested by simulating browser and app usage. AnTuTu version 9 can compare any ARM CPU running on Android or iOS. Devices may not be directly comparable when benchmarked on different operating systems.

In the AnTuTu 9 benchmark, the single-core performance of a processor is only slightly weighted. The rating is made up of the multi-core performance of the processor, the speed of the working memory, and the performance of the internal graphics.
